Walter Smith Randolph is an award-winning investigative journalist and newsroom leader, currently serving as the Executive Producer of Investigations at CBS News New York. His investigative reporting has been honored with a New York Emmy Award, a national and three regional Edward R. Murrow awards, and a national Sigma Delta Chi Award.
Before his return to his native New York City, Walter launched and led The Accountability Project at Connecticut Public Broadcasting in 2021. His unit produced long-form audio reports, podcasts, and television documentaries for the statewide PBS and NPR stations. Through fundraising efforts, Walter helped double the size of the station’s first investigative team.
Prior to returning to the East Coast, Walter spent more than a decade honing his skills as a reporter and anchor across various markets. His journey took him to stations in Elmira, NY (WENY); Flint, MI (WEYI); Kalamazoo, MI (WWMT); and Cincinnati, OH (WKRC).
Walter is also committed to shaping the future of journalism. As Vice President-Broadcast of the National Association of Black Journalists (NABJ), he advocates for a more equitable media landscape. He previously served as NABJ’s Treasurer for three years. As an Adjunct Assistant Professor at CUNY’s Newmark Graduate School of Journalism, Walter teaches and mentors the next generation of journalists. He also serves as a trainer for the Ida B. Wells Society for Investigative Reporting.
Walter earned his Bachelor’s degree in communication from Villanova University and a Master’s degree in journalism from CUNY’s Newmark Graduate School of Journalism. He is a member of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c., and Investigative Reporters & Editors (IRE).
